Output 93b8fef1defbd4f999cd8bf7e7193996bca577cc07e5ec100fee1440e6082739:1

value
8667853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06290e9a3930bf8f05fcca1a87befd0387dfd40c OP_EQUAL
address
32FbAPTHKdbsd19HTq5kG79HE1FcwavwK7
transaction
93b8fef1defbd4f999cd8bf7e7193996bca577cc07e5ec100fee1440e6082739
spent
true